Man kills wife with hammer & knife while she slept; arrested in Bokaro

Bokaro, Nov 9 (UNI) A man allegedly killed his wife while she was asleep in DVC Rehabilitated Colony, Naya Basti, under the Bokaro Thermal Police Station area of the district.
According to police sources, the accused, Rupesh Yadav (35), brutally attacked his wife Jhalo Devi (30) by crushing her head with a hammer and then slitting her throat with a knife on late Saturday night. The horrifying incident occurred around 2:30 a.m. in the presence of their three young children seven-year-old daughter Riddhi Rani, four-year-old son Piyush, and one and a half year old daughter.
Hearing her mother's screams, the eldest daughter woke up and began crying, alerting Rupesh's mother, 65-year-old Nunwa Devi, who rushed to the room. When the door was opened, she found Jhalo Devi lying lifeless in a pool of blood. Villagers immediately caught the accused and handed him over to the police.
